TURN-208: Gatevale turnstile counters at the Merrow Field pilot double-count when a rotation reverses mid-cycle. Attendance totals drift roughly 2% high per event. The debounce window fix is implemented, reviewed by Ilsa, and soak-tested across two simulated match days without drift. Ready for your cut; the candidate build is identified below.

trace token, tagag-tafog: htk6_5ed18c

**Changelog — Ledgerline v2.9**

Renamed `ORDERS_SOFTDEL` to `ORDERS_SOFT_DELETE_ENABLED` for clarity. Behavior is unchanged: deleted rows in the orders table get a `deleted_at` timestamp and are excluded from default queries. The nightly purge job still removes rows older than 90 days. If the purge job fails to start on your shift, confirm the env file includes the purge service credential on the following line:

secret setting of yagef-baweg: RELAY_SECRET29=cb53deb59a49ed54d9f43599b54ca

Producers must honor this header; retry storms are the primary abuse vector reviewers should assess. All backpressure telemetry is exposed on the internal metrics endpoint, which is authenticated separately from the public API. Requests to that endpoint must present the internal service key given below.

gateway credential: kto3_qfe